Continued Discussion from June 7. 2005 Meetino Reqardino Annual Eye Examinations Board Attorney Beck reported that his research revealed there is no provision in the Revised Code of Washington or Washington Administrative Code that would limit one eye examination per year. Policy 9.01 (K) provides that medical expenses which are necessary, shall be reimbursed. Policy 9.02(C) provides for reimbursement of eye examination, but no time limit is provided. The policies also provide that lenses and frames (up to $200.00) will be reimbursed annually. There is no limit on the frequency for eye examinations if the examination is medically necessary. V.
